What is a Rock Choir Leader?
A Rock Choir Leader is the heart and soul of a local Rock Choir group — they’re the ones who lead rehearsals, bring the energy, and make the magic happen!A Rock Choir Leader is a professional musician (a singer with piano/keyboard skills) who:
- Leads weekly choir rehearsals
- Teaches our unique Contemporary arrangements in an engaging, accessible way
- Brings fun, energy, and encouragement to every session
- Creates a safe and uplifting environment where anyone can enjoy singing – no matter what their background or experience in music is
- Conducts performances, local gigs, and larger events like arena shows or media appearances
